    Popped in for the first time with a friend that was putting together holiday baskets for clients. I'm so happy she did, I would have never found this place on my own. It's teeny tiny store front that is adjacent to a liquor store with a funny name... My friend bought a few trays of amazing cookies and pastries that would be the centerpiece at any holiday gathering (as if we were "allowed" to have holiday gatherings in 2020. But hey, they are freezable right? I purchased the Nutella Napol pastry which was a great bargain for $2.50. It's enough for 2 adults. you could divide it into quarters to be modest, then go back for a second helping if you don't want to be glutenous... actually glutenous would be more apt if you ate the whole thing... which is totally plausible. That's why they have a smaller single serving size for those without self control. I prefer to take a little piece and go back for seconds. But to each their own. (see what pronoun I used there? so PC) I also bought a package of mixed apricot and raspberry pastry that will be great with coffee or tea. Again, the goal is not intensionally or unintentionally eat them all in one sitting. They are little two bites of perfectly light and airy crunchy pastry with a sweet tart swath of jam, sprinkled with powdered sugar. AND! If your attempts with cookie cutters and royal icing turn you into a Grinch this holiday season, they offer a colorful assortment of decorated cookies that are good for eating or display. I'll definitely come back again!

    Amazing spot for Armenian baked goods, kabobs, desserts, and has a similar vibe to Porto's, but…read morewith an Armenian twist. Stopped by because I've been on an Armenian pastry trend at this time. I ended up grabbing some nazook, medium lahmajun, and also decided to give the beef khachapuri kabob a try as I haven't seen that offered at other spots I've tried. Service was quick and on point and the lahmajun did take about 10-15 minutes as they make them fresh. They have a pretty expansive patio where you can enjoy your goodies and hang out. Parking can be a bit of a challenge as it is mostly street parking, but I managed to snag a spot a few blocks away. As for the food, the nazook is amazing and better than a few other bakeries I've tried in Glendale. The lahmajun was also amazing and very flavorful with a good amount of meat. And lastly, the beef khachapuri kabob was amazing! It had that nice smoky charcoal flavor in the meat and worked well with the surrounding pastry. Definitely will be back again and bringing friends to this Glendale gem!

    I have to say I really enjoyed my first visit to Art's!…read more I stopped by on a weekday morning and it was pretty quiet but the nice lady behind the counter was so friendly and helpful! I mentioned it was my first time and ordered a cheese byorek, custard Napoleon and americano, but when she brought my food out on a plate there were a couple extra nazook pastries I didn't ask for. When I mentioned it she said "it's okay it's your first time". So kind of her! the pastries and coffee I paid for came to about $15, the pastries were pretty big so I felt like it was a good deal. The cheese byorek was so flaky and puffy with a really tasty cheese filling throughout. It was still crispy too! Although I liked the flavors of the napoleon, sadly it wasn't crispy at all and pretty soggy. I'm not sure how long this sat in the display but the texture was my only disappointment about it. Coffee was good, simple, and the barista was very nice too. As for the nazook - they were amazing! Me and my mom make nazook at home all the time, but with nuts and a few differences. This did not have any filling per se but it was so fluffy and chewy and crispy on the outside and all buttery goodness! I will definitely be back to Art's
